We will visit the only medieval castle within metro distance of the city of Paris.  My commented tour will provide the context & historical background for this unique location – to help you better understand the “how” and “why” of a typical medieval castle.

We will take the metro from Paris to the castle.  Along the way, I will explain to you & your family about life in the Middle Ages using researched documentation, photos & pictures.  You will learn how people lived in the Middle Ages, how the Castle was constructed & its history – from royal palace to prison.

We will then visit the castle itself, touring the entire building from the top of the battlements down to the dungeons.  We will take the drawbridge over the moat & enter through the main tower. Then we will visit the keep & its residential area. We’ll make the rounds on the wooden terrace which commands views for miles around. We will climb a dizzying spiral staircase to the top of the castle & visit the battlements with its bell tower, just like the solders who once guarded the castle. Then we will descend into the dungeons & servant’s quarter

Along the way I will provide commentary on life in the Middle Ages, how the king & his court lived. I will provide the historical context to help you & your kids learn abut life in the Middle Ages!  Your kids will love it
